"With an average increase of 15% in salaries and adjustments of JD40 and JD45 for inflation along with enhanced packages, Nuqul Group promises its human resources better working environment responding to the rise in the cost of living and the current economic conditions,"
said Mr. Nicola Billeh, Human Resource Director at Nuqul Group.
Mr. Billeh added: "We are committed to continuously develop our most treasured asset, our people. We always seek new agreements and partnerships with renowned entities such as the Labor Union to foster our appreciation of the value of diversity operating in a competitive environment. We grant equal opportunity in all aspects of employment to all qualified persons with an obligation towards staff who seek growth to fulfill their aspirations and goals."
"Our agreement positions Nuqul Group as the leading Jordanian industrial conglomerate in the field of compensating employees through attractive offers ensuring employee satisfaction and nourishing the strong sense of belonging," said Mr. Mohammad Al Zoubi CEO of the Labor Union.
"Without any doubt this agreement fosters our relation with the private sector represented by Nuqul Group and serves the economy of our country by enhancing the wheel of production towards growth and development," added Mr. Al Zoubi.
Established in 1952, Nuqul Group brings together 30 regional and global companies, more than 5,500 employees and exports its products to over 45 exports markets worldwide.
